[oe] [meta-networking][PATCH v2] firewalld: update to 0.7.1

Dan Callaghan dan.callaghan at opengear.com
Fri Oct 4 03:11:25 UTC 2019


Excerpts from Dan Callaghan's message of 2019-10-04 11:34:06 +10:00:
> Excerpts from Khem Raj's message of 2019-09-30 20:21:38 -07:00:
> > Fails in configure
> >
> > https://errors.yoctoproject.org/Errors/Details/272275/
> >
> > perhaps xmlto-native docbook-xml-dtd4-native
> > docbook-xsl-stylesheets-native deps are needed
> 
> Hmm. The recipe already has docbook-xsl-stylesheets-native and
> xmlto-native in DEPENDS, which should be sufficient.
> 
> The recipe I posted in v2 of my patch builds successfully in our distro,
> which is based on Thud. The recipe sysroot has /etc/xml/catalog.xml in
> it, and it contains the Docbook XML stuff as expected.
> 
> But when I build the recipe in YOE master, I can see that the Docbook
> XML is present in the recipe sysroot XML catalog... but the catalog file
> is called /etc/xml/catalog, not /etc/xml/catalog.xml.
> 
> I wonder if it has changed since Thud, or if there is some other reason
> why the name is different in our distro...

Oh, I think I found it. It is due to this change, which is in Warrior:

http://cgit.openembedded.org/openembedded-core/commit/?id=b12686ecdd0b0bdb36c8d1a2baeeb66aadff1b8c

Now the docbook-xsl-stylesheets-native recipe will itself put a working 
catalog into the sysroot, I can drop the dependency on xmlto-native. And 
the correct filename is apparently now /etc/xml/catalog.

I'll have to just keep my older version of the recipe in our distro 
while we are still on Thud.

-- 
Dan Callaghan <dan.callaghan at opengear.com>
Software Engineer
Opengear <https://opengear.com/>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: not available
URL: <http://lists.openembedded.org/pipermail/openembedded-devel/attachments/20191004/db5b5026/attachment-0001.sig>


More information about the Openembedded-devel mailing list